What you’ll do in this role:

  • Training Delivery:
    • Conduct engaging and effective training sessions for existing employees, ensuring comprehension and application of key concepts.
    • Utilize a variety of instructional techniques to accommodate different learning styles.
    • Facilitate workshops, webinars, and on-the-job training sessions as needed.
  • Compliance and Regulatory Training:
    • Stay informed about industry regulations and compliance requirements.
    • Develop and deliver training programs to ensure employees are knowledgeable and compliant with relevant laws and regulations.
  • Technology Integration:
    • Leverage technology and e-learning platforms to enhance training delivery and accessibility.
    • Stay current on industry trends and incorporate innovative approaches to training.
  • Process Analysis:
    • Evaluate existing pharmacy processes to identify inefficiencies, bottlenecks, and areas for improvement.
    • Use process mapping and analysis tools to understand workflow and dependencies.
  • Training and Development:
    • Work with the Director of Staff Development to integrate process improvement into staff training programs.
    • Provide ongoing support and training as needed.
  • Continuous Improvement Initiatives:
    • Identify opportunities for continuous improvement in pharmacy operations.
    • Implement initiatives to streamline processes and enhance overall efficiency.

We are looking for a compassionate Travel Staff Development Specialist with:

  • 2 Years Experience in a training role in specialty pharmacy or similar field
  • Required to travel 50-70% of the time for on site training
  • A strong understanding of pharmaceuticals, pharmacology, and pharmacy operations is essential to effectively train and develop pharmacy staff.
